CBS News Chicago is seeking a skilled and experienced news production professional with expertise in local news production, including field, studio, and transmission work. This role supports broadcast and multi-platform social media strategies, as well as cbschicago.com.
Responsibilities
- Operate studio equipment, including teleprompter, jib, editing systems, and transmission control
- Handle field duties such as professional operation of broadcast cameras, drones, digital microwave, non-linear editing systems, and IP-based broadcast applications
- Demonstrate knowledge and experience with ENG news and studio production, including Sony HD cameras, Edius non-linear editing, jib, teleprompter, and lighting
- Safely operate company vehicles, including microwave-equipped vans and trucks, in all weather conditions and potentially long drives
- Bring creativity and imagination to broadcast storytelling
- Meet daily show production deadlines
- Protect news equipment from theft and damage
- Contribute to the editorial process with story ideas and production strategy
- Work all shifts, including nights, weekends, early mornings, and holidays, based on production needs
- Perform physically demanding tasks, such as carrying and manipulating at least 75 lbs of gear, setting up and breaking down broadcast production equipment, often alone and on tight deadlines
- Drive and position large microwave-equipped vans, operate retractable antenna masts, execute long cable runs, and handle tripods, video cameras, and batteries
- Adapt to writing content for air and contribute to social media strategies and multimedia journalism
- Handle complex logistical situations in the field, including interacting with fire, police, and security personnel
- Communicate reliably and professionally with coworkers and the public
Requirements
- Five years’ experience as a photographer, editor, and studio technician, preferably in a top 30 market
- Bachelor’s degree in journalism, media production, or a similar field (or related experience)
- Familiarity with the Chicago area
- Strong non-linear editing background, including Edius
- Valid Illinois driver’s license
- Drone ENG experience with FAA Part 107 certification (a plus)
- Ability to handle physically and emotionally stressful assignments, including unpredictable news situations requiring extended shifts on short notice
- Flexibility in work schedule, including weekends, late nights, and overnights
